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a Structural Engineer cost in Knaresborough?
Fees vary by scope: surveys typically £400–£800, calculations £500–£2000. Always seek written quotes for your specific project before committing.
Do I need Structural Engineer approval for a loft conversion in Knaresborough?
Yes. Building Control requires calculations confirming the structure can support new floor loading. Your engineer prepares designs and liaises with Local Authority.
Is my Knaresborough house subsidence prone?
Knaresborough's limestone bedrock and clay subsoils carry modest subsidence risk. A structural engineer can investigate cracks, monitor movement, and recommend remedial works if needed.
